Parasympathetic System
Part of the autonomic nervous system that conserves energy as it slows the heart rate, increases intestinal and gland activity, and relaxes sphincter muscles.
Hormonal Transmission
The process by which hormones are released into the bloodstream by endocrine glands and then travel to target organs or tissues to exert their effects.
Hypertension
A chronic medical condition where the blood pressure in the arteries is persistently elevated, potentially leading to significant health issues.
